Arizona United Soccer Club continues its march to the regular season with its fifth preseason match of the season.

In their previous match, a 0-0 draw with fellow USL side OC Blues FC, United created plenty of chances but couldn't find the back of the net.

Said head coach Frank Yallop after the match: "We can always work on finishing. Game situations are different. ... We could've scored four goals. We made the good runs. But the last little bit, the sharpness in front of goal is probably the last thing to come."

While the offensive sharpness isn't quite there, the club looks very sharp on the defensive end. Arizona kept the Blues scoreless against the Blues, and against Indy Eleven, the starters also kept the ball out of the net in the first half. (Indy's four goals came against mostly trialists in the second half).

Scouting Report: Grand Canyon University is currently in their spring training camp. The team went 7-10 in the fall last season with a 3-7 record in conference play. They lost their leading point scorer to graduation, but will return players two through four on the point-scoring list (Nicki Jackson, Damian German, and Alexandros Halis).

Previous meetings: Arizona United fell to the Antelopes, 3-1, in their only previous meeting.
